What is Methylergometrine Maleate?

Methylergometrine Maleate is a prescription medication used to prevent and treat excessive bleeding after childbirth. It belongs to the ergot alkaloids class and is administered via intramuscular, intravenous, or subcutaneous routes. Commonly prescribed postpartum to support uterine contraction.

What is Methylergometrine Maleate used for?

Methylergometrine Maleate is primarily used to prevent or reduce heavy bleeding following delivery or abortion. It works by causing the uterus to contract, which helps control postpartum hemorrhage. What are the side effects of Methylergometrine Maleate?

After administration, Methylergometrine Maleate typically causes the uterus to contract more strongly and frequently. This effect helps reduce blood loss by tightening the uterine muscles. Some patients may experience mild side effects such as nausea, vomiting, or dizziness. These effects are generally temporary and monitored by healthcare providers.

What precautions apply to Methylergometrine Maleate?

Methylergometrine Maleate should only be used under medical supervision due to its potent effects on uterine contractions. It is not suitable for patients with certain conditions like high blood pressure or heart disease. Always inform your healthcare provider about your medical history before use. What does Methylergometrine Maleate interact with?

Methylergometrine Maleate may interact with medications that affect blood pressure, such as beta-blockers or vasoconstrictors. Combining it with certain antibiotics or antifungals could also alter its effects. Avoid alcohol and herbal supplements unless approved by a doctor. Always disclose all medications you are taking to your healthcare provider.

Frequently asked questions

What are the common side effects of Methylergometrine Maleate?+
Common side effects may include nausea, vomiting, dizziness, or headache. These effects are usually mild and temporary.
How is Methylergometrine Maleate administered?+
It is given as an injection into a muscle, vein, or under the skin, typically in a clinical setting.
Can Methylergometrine Maleate be used during pregnancy?+
This medication is specifically used postpartum to prevent bleeding and is not intended for use during pregnancy.
Is Methylergometrine Maleate safe for breastfeeding mothers?+
It is prescribed postpartum and may pass into breast milk; consult your doctor before breastfeeding.
